Washington County DA decides not to file criminal charges in shooting

By

The Washington County District Attorney says he applied the state’s new “castle doctrine”in deciding not tofile criminal charges against a homeowner who shot and killed an unarmed 20-year-old man who was hiding on his porch. Gilman Halsted has details.
